Transaction df4eed023144ec7971a624d7d4490cf7cb2518085bcd06e546a034e4d7413c5e
1 Input
1 Output
-
df4eed023144ec7971a624d7d4490cf7cb2518085bcd06e546a034e4d7413c5e:0
- value
- 19211589
- script pubkey
- OP_0 OP_PUSHBYTES_20 f51a16663f0e5d8787756058bc20197f05297ac4
- address
- bc1q75dpve3lpewc0pm4vpvtcgqe0uzjj7ky5gqq86